PUBLIC COMMENT PERIOD FOR ITEMS NOT ON THE AGENDA
(not to exceed 15 minutes total)
The Council welcomes your input. You may address the Council by completing a speaker slip
and giving it to the City Clerk prior to the meeting. At this time, you may address the Council
on items that are not on the agenda. Time limit is three minutes. State law does not allow the
Council to discuss or take action on issues not on the agenda, except that members of the
Council or staff may briefly respond to statements made or questions posed by persons
exercising their public testimony rights (Gov. Code sec. 54954.2). Staff may be asked to
follow up on such items.

CONSENT AGENDA
Matters appearing on the Consent Calendar are expected to be non-controversial and will be
acted upon at one time. A member of the public may request the Council to pull an item for
discussion. Pulled items shall be heard at the close of the Consent Agenda unless a majority of
the Council chooses another time. The public may comment on any and all items on the
Consent Agenda within the three-minute time limit.

12. AWARD OF SOUTH HILLS RADIO SITE UPGRADES PROJECT,
SPECIFICATION NO. 91584 (STANWYCK / KLOEPPER)
Recommendation:
1. Award a construction contract to Specialty Construction, Inc. in the amount of
$760,270.25 for the South Hills Radio Site Upgrades Project; and
2. Approve a transfer of $138,012 from the Information Technology Replacement Fund
Undesignated Capital Account to the Community Safety Emergency Response
Communication Equipment Account to fund the project.

16. 2019-20 MID-YEAR BUDGET REVIEW (ELKE / HARNETT – 40 MINUTES)
Recommendation:
1. Receive and discuss an update to the City’s work programs, workload and performance
measures, and changes in financial positions based on revised projections for all funds
for the 2019-20 fiscal year; and
2. Receive an update on the status of the current Major City Goals; and
3. Receive an update on the status of the Capital Improvement Plan; and
4. Adopt a Resolution entitled, “A Resolution of the City Council of the City of San Luis
Obispo, California, approving an amendment to the 2019-20 Budget Allocation,” to
approve the transfer of $380,000 from the City’s Capital Reserve to begin security
related projects and to appropriate $179,910 of over-realized development services
revenue into the Development Services Designation; and
5. Approve one full-time equivalent (FTE) position in support of the reorganization of
Community Services departments.
